Toddler Playground Safety Features

Toddler playground safety features are an essential consideration when choosing a playground for your child. A safe playground can help prevent injuries and ensure that your child has a fun and enjoyable play experience. For example, look for playgrounds with soft landing surfaces like rubber mulch or wood chips, which can help cushion falls and prevent injuries. You should also consider playgrounds with sturdy fencing and gates, which can help prevent your child from wandering off or getting into harm’s way.

When evaluating the safety features of a toddler playground, consider the materials used to construct the playground. Look for playgrounds made from durable, non-toxic materials that can withstand heavy use and harsh weather conditions. You should also consider the design of the playground, looking for features like gentle slopes, rounded edges, and secure ladders and stairs. These features can help reduce the risk of injury and ensure that your child has a safe and enjoyable play experience.

In addition to the physical safety features of the playground, you should also consider the safety of the surrounding area. Make sure that the playground is located in a safe and secure area, away from hazards like roads, pools, and power lines. You should also consider the supervision requirements of the playground, looking for features like benches and shade structures that can help you keep a close eye on your child.

Some popular safety features to look for in a toddler playground include impact-absorbing surfaces, secure anchoring systems, and tamper-resistant hardware. These features can help create a safe and secure play environment for your child, while also providing peace of mind for parents and caregivers. By choosing a playground with robust safety features, you can help ensure that your child has a fun and enjoyable play experience without compromising their safety.

Safety Features

Safety features are a top priority when it comes to toddler playgrounds. You want to ensure that your child is protected from any potential hazards, such as sharp edges, toxic materials, or unstable structures. Look for playgrounds made from high-quality, non-toxic materials that are designed with safety in mind. A good playground should also have a soft, padded surface to cushion any falls. Additionally, consider the presence of safety gates, fences, or enclosures to prevent your child from wandering off or accessing any hazardous areas.

When evaluating safety features, be sure to check for any certifications or compliance with safety standards, such as those set by the American Society for Testing and Materials (ASTM) or the U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C). These organizations provide guidelines and regulations for playground safety, and compliance with these standards can give you peace of mind as a parent. Additionally, read reviews and do your research to find a playground that has a proven track record of safety and durability. By prioritizing safety features, you can help ensure that your child has a fun and secure play experience.

What safety features should I look for when choosing a toddler playground?

When selecting a toddler playground, safety should be your top priority. Look for playgrounds with soft, impact-absorbing surfaces, such as rubber or wood chips, to reduce the risk of injury from falls. The playground equipment should be sturdy, well-maintained, and securely anchored to the ground. Additionally, check for any sharp edges, points, or small parts that can be a choking hazard. It’s also essential to ensure that the playground is designed for your child’s age group, with equipment that is suitable for their size and skill level.

A safe toddler playground should also have adequate adult supervision and seating areas, allowing you to keep a close eye on your child while they play. Furthermore, consider the playground’s location, ensuring it is situated in a safe and accessible area, away from traffic and other potential hazards. By choosing a playground with these safety features, you can have peace of mind while your child plays, explores, and learns. Remember, safety is an ongoing process, so be sure to regularly inspect the playground and report any concerns to the manufacturer or authorities.

What types of materials are used to make toddler playgrounds, and are they safe?

Toddler playgrounds are made from a variety of materials, including wood, metal, plastic, and recycled materials. When choosing a playground, look for materials that are durable, weather-resistant, and safe for your child. Wooden playgrounds, for example, are a popular choice, as they are natural, sturdy, and can be made from sustainable sources. Metal playgrounds are also common, as they are strong and can withstand heavy use. Plastic playgrounds are another option, as they are lightweight, easy to clean, and can be made from recycled materials.

Regardless of the material, ensure that the playground is made from non-toxic, lead-free, and phthalate-free materials. Check the manufacturer’s certifications, such as those from the International Play Equipment Manufacturers Association (IPEMA) or the American Society for Testing and Materials (ASTM), to ensure that the playground meets safety standards. Additionally, consider the environmental impact of the materials used and opt for eco-friendly options whenever possible. By choosing a playground made from safe and sustainable materials, you can have confidence in the quality and safety of the play equipment.

How do I maintain and clean my toddler playground to ensure it remains safe and hygienic?

Maintaining and cleaning your toddler playground is essential to ensure it remains safe and hygienic. Regularly inspect the playground equipment for any signs of wear and tear, and perform routine maintenance tasks, such as tightening loose screws and lubricating moving parts. Clean the playground surfaces and equipment regularly, using mild soap and water, to prevent the buildup of dirt, grime, and germs. Additionally, consider implementing a schedule for deep cleaning and disinfecting the playground, especially during flu season or after an illness.

To make cleaning easier, consider using playground equipment with smooth, easy-to-clean surfaces, and av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ners that can damage the materials. You can also add a shade structure or a canopy to protect the playground from the elements and reduce the need for frequent cleaning. By maintaining and cleaning your toddler playground regularly, you can help prevent accidents, reduce the risk of illness, and ensure that your child has a safe and healthy play environment.
